In today's digital world, having a strong online presence is crucial for businesses and individuals alike. A streamlined and user-friendly website is the key to attracting and retaining customers. This is where front-end development services come into play. Front-end development involves the creation and optimization of the visual and interactive elements of a website. It focuses on enhancing the user experience, making navigation seamless, and ensuring that the website is responsive across different devices. With the ever-evolving digital landscape, investing in front-end development services is essential for creating a digital presence that stands out and drives success.
What is Front-end Development?
Optimizing the performance of a digital platform is a key factor in front-end development. Code optimization and removing unnecessary elements helps to quicken loading speed and overall performance, thus avoiding the risk of a high bounce rate due to slow loading times. Additionally, front-end development ensures accessibility for users with disabilities, helping to make the digital platform available to a broader audience.
Compatibility across different browsers and devices is another factor in front-end development. As mobile use continues to increase, it is essential for websites and applications to be responsive and adapt to various screen sizes. Responsive design techniques enable front-end developers to create a consistent user experience no matter what device is being used.
Benefits of Front-end Development
Front-end development brings countless advantages to companies aiming to establish a smooth digital presence. Enhancing user experience is one of the chief benefits of front-end development, as it allows websites and applications to be easily navigable and available across a range of devices through the implementation of responsive design. This not only lifts customer satisfaction but also heightens the chances of conversions and retention. Furthermore, front-end development enables the inclusion of interactive elements such as animations and dynamic content, boosting user engagement and making the digital experience more gratifying and memorable.
Optimizing website performance is another great benefit of front-end development. By compressing files, optimizing code, and implementing caching techniques, front-end developers can reduce page load times, which not only enhances the user experience but also improves search engine rankings. Webpages that load faster are more likely to rank higher in results, leading to more organic traffic and visibility. Additionally, efficient front-end development ensures that websites are compatible with various browsers and platforms, minimizing the risk of any compatibility issues and maximizing reach.
Front-end development also has remarkable scalability and flexibility. Having a solid front-end foundation allows businesses to quickly modify and update their digital assets to reflect shifting trends, user preferences, or business necessities. This agile nature allows for immediate adaptation to market demands, ensuring that websites and applications stay current and competitive. Moreover, front-end development facilitates the easy integration of other technologies and platforms, making possible the incorporation of APIs, third-party tools, and data exchange. This integration expands functionality and unlocks new possibilities for growth and innovation.
Finally, front-end development is crucial for brand consistency and recognition. By implementing consistent design elements, typography, and color schemes, front-end developers create a unified visual identity that aligns with the brand's values and messaging. This uniformity across digital channels helps to raise brand recognition and trust, as users can quickly recognize and associate the website or application with the business. Furthermore, front-end development allows for the seamless integration of social media buttons and sharing options, empowering businesses to take advantage of social media for increased brand awareness and engagement.
Strategies for Optimizing Front-end Development
For optimal front-end development, prioritizing website speed and performance is essential. This can be achieved by minimizing file size and limiting HTTP requests. Furthermore, caching and optimizing images can further optimize website speed. By following these strategies, businesses can create a website that loads quickly and provides a seamless user experience.
To guarantee cross-browser compatibility, rigorous testing and the utilization of compatibility tools and frameworks is necessary. This ensures consistent functionality and appearance across various browsers, devices, and platforms. With this, businesses can reach a wider audience and ensure that their website performs optimally.
Responsive design is also an important strategy for improving front-end development. By using media queries and flexible layouts, websites can adjust seamlessly to different screen sizes and resolutions. This creates a user-friendly experience on any device, resulting in higher engagement and conversion rates.
Tools for Front-end Development
For successful front-end development, the right tools are essential. Text editors, version control systems, task runners, and build tools can all simplify the development process and improve the final product. A text editor is a must-have for any developer, providing features like syntax highlighting and code suggestions. Version control systems, such as Git, are invaluable for tracking changes and facilitating collaboration. Task runners and build tools like Gulp and Grunt can automate tedious tasks, saving time and energy.
When working in teams, collaboration and communication are essential. Project management tools like Jira and Trello help teams stay organized and assign tasks. Communication tools like Slack and Microsoft Teams enable discussion and real-time collaboration. Documentation tools like Confluence and Notion allow developers to document code and share knowledge. These tools promote cooperation, streamline productivity, and ensure everyone is on the same page.
Tips for Working with Front-end Development Professionals
To ensure a smooth and successful collaboration with front-end development professionals, clear communication and open dialogue are paramount. Establish your expectations, objectives, and deadlines, and be open to their advice and expertise. Additionally, create a timeline with achievable milestones, and provide regular check-ins and feedback.
Moreover, it's essential to build a strong working relationship and maintain a consistent dialogue. Keep them apprised of any updates or changes, and be prompt in responding to their queries or requests. Taking the time to nurture a trusting environment can lead to a more enjoyable and productive working experience.
By following these tips, you can streamline the process of working with front-end development professionals and construct a powerful digital presence for your business. Clear communication, regular check-ins, and timely feedback are key to achieving this goal. Additionally, investing in a strong relationship with the professionals can help foster a successful collaboration.
In conclusion, front-end development services play a crucial role in creating a streamlined digital presence for businesses. With its ability to enhance user experience, optimize website performance, and ensure compatibility across different devices, front-end development is essential in today's competitive online landscape. By implementing effective strategies, utilizing the right tools, and working with experienced professionals, businesses can unlock the full potential of their digital platforms. So, whether you're a small startup or a large corporation, investing in front-end development is a smart move that can lead to increased engagement, conversions, and overall success in the digital world.